    +12V +12V 2.3.1 Power Button Connector SECOnITX-ION board is able to work in ATX mode, following ACPI specifications for Power Management. For this reason, on board there is a connector carrying signals for the Power Button (to be used to put the system in a Soft Off State, or awake from it), for Reset Button, and for an eventual intruder switch (managed directly by MMP9 Embedded ION Chipset).

    3.3 Connectors Description 3.3.1 Compact Flash socket Mass storage capabilities of SECOnITX-ION includes the possibility to use Compact Flash cards, that can be connected to the board using socket CN6, that is a standard Compact Flash Socket, type JST ICM-MA50H-SS52-1141 or equivalent.

    Serial port COM1 can also be configured, via SW, to work in RS-485mode. In this case, signals for RS-485 port are carried out on a 3 pin p2mm connector type MOLEX 89400-0320 or equivalent, with the following pin-out.     To add communications functionality, or other features not already implemented in the board SECOnITX-ION, is it possible to use mini-PCI Express cards, using the dedicate connector CN10, that is a standard 52pin miniPCI Express connector, type JAE MM60-52B1-E1-R650 or equivalent, H=5.9mm.

    Line_In-Right 3.3.12 GPIO Connector Other than standard Input/Outputs, on SECOnITX-ION board there is also the possibility of using up to 8 General Purpose Input/Outputs (GPIO), coming out from a dedicated microcontroller, Texas Instruments MSP430F2122IPWR. Access to these GPIO can be done using a dedicated library, which can be supplied by SECO.
